Sometimes there's no service charge at all, but still a line for a tip. … WebMay 15, 2012 · Here’s where it can get tricky: A “service charge” includes the tip. But a tip is not included in a “room service charge” or the more commonly used “delivery fee” or “delivery charge.” So in the case of my burger, the $3.00 delivery charge was not a tip but the $3.78 service charge was (calculated as 18% of $21.00).
